We describe a free air transmission method for the determination of the permittivity of lossy liquids in the frequency range 26–110 GHz and the temperature range -5 to 70 °C. For pure water the method gives permittivity values with a dispersion of less than 3% about the true value. We give new permittivity data for an aqueous NaCl solution and for synthetic sea water in the temperature range -2 to 30 °C.
